Do It Yourself Repairs for Common Problems
While some patio door issues may require professional intervention, many repairs can be performed by property owners with basic tools. Here are some typical issues and DIY options:
1. MisalignmentService: Adjusting the RollersTools Needed: Screwdriver, adjustable wrenchActions:Locate the roller change screws at the bottom of the Top-Rated Door Installers.Utilize the screwdriver or adjustable wrench to raise or decrease the door by turning the screws clockwise or counterclockwise.Evaluate the door's operation to ensure it opens and closes efficiently.2. Harmed Weather StrippingOption: ReplacementTools Needed: Utility knife, adhesive, new weather condition strippingActions:Remove the old weather removing utilizing the utility knife.Tidy the area to get rid of any adhesive residues.Step and cut the new weather condition removing to size.Use the adhesive and press the brand-new weather condition stripping into place.3. Broken GlassService: Glass ReplacementTools Needed: Safety gloves, putty knife, replacement glass, caulkSteps:Carefully get rid of the damaged glass and tidy the frame.Fit the brand-new glass into the frame.Apply caulk around the edges to seal it.Allow it to dry according to the directions supplied on the caulk.4. Faulty LocksService: Clean or Replace LockTools Needed: Lubricant, screwdriverActions:Apply lube to the lock mechanism.If the locking system stays malfunctioning, remove the lock with a screwdriver.Change it with a brand-new lock, following maker guidelines.5. Sticking DoorSolution: Clean Tracks and RealignTools Needed: Vacuum, soap and water, lubricantSteps:Clean the tracks completely to remove dirt and particles.Check the positioning and make adjustments as needed.Apply a lightweight lubricant to ensure smooth operation.6. Frequently Asked Questions About Patio Door Repair1. How much does it cost to repair a patio door?
Repair costs can vary commonly based on the concern, products, and professional repair charges. Basic repairs like changing weather condition removing may cost in between ₤ 50 and ₤ 150, while changing glass or complex lock systems can reach ₤ 300 or more.
2. Can I replace simply one part of the door?
Yes, lots of parts of patio doors can be replaced separately, including locks, rollers, and weather removing.
3. How can I avoid future problems with my patio door?
Regular maintenance, such as cleaning tracks, lubricating systems, and checking for wear, can assist extend the life of your Patio Door Upgrades door.
4. How do I know if I require to replace my patio door rather than repair it?
Signs consist of extensive damage, such as warping, deteriorated frames, or numerous problems happening simultaneously. A professional examination can assist determine if replacement is necessary.
